Problem Alignments

Hi, this my example:

            STARTUP    =ALIGNMENT/START,RECALL:,LIST=YES
            ALIGNMENT/END
            MODE/DCC
            MOVESPEED/ 100
            FORMAT/TEXT,OPTIONS, ,HEADINGS,SYMBOLS, ;NOM,TOL,MEAS,DEV,OUTTOL, , 
            LOADPROBE/1MM
            ASSIGN/AUX=1
            IF_GOTO/AUX==1,GOTO = A1
            IF_GOTO/AUX==2,GOTO = A2
I0         =LABEL/
            MOVE/POINT,NORMAL,<0,0,200>
            PROGRAM/END

A1         =LABEL/
            RECALL/ALIGNMENT,EXTERNAL,a1,ALINHAMENTO_BASE_1:a1
            GOTO/I0
A2         =LABEL/
            RECALL/ALIGNMENT,EXTERNAL,a1,ALINHAMENTO_BASE_2:a1
            GOTO/I0


I want use 2 alignments in the same program... but this dont work... Any Solution?

  • What is the big picture for what you are trying to do? You have two similar threads on this and both of them are essentially the same problem. PCDMIS will use the last active setting you see as you read your program for many of it's features, regardless of whether or not you have executed that part of the program. It will not use the last setting you think you set but the last setting there in "chronological" order, that's the way the software works. Give us an overview of what you think you want your program to do and maybe we can save you a lot of headaches trying to make it do things it can't.
